- The distance between Monterrey, Mexico and Zaranj, Afghanistan is approximately 13,434 km or 8,348 mi.
- To reach Monterrey in this distance one would set out from Zaranj bearing 341.2°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Monterrey bearing 197.8° or SSW .
- Monterrey has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Zaranj has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Monterrey is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Zaranj is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 1 °C (1.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 15 °C (27°F) less in Monterrey.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 568.5 mm (22.4 in) more which is equivalent to 568.5 l/m² (13.95 US gal/ft²) or 5,685,000 l/ha (607,764 US gal/ac) more. About 12 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.3° higher in Monterrey than in Zaranj.
- Relative humidity levels are 24.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 8.6°C (15.5°F) higher.
